Guinea-Bissau: People using at least basic sanitation services (% of population)

In , Guinea-Bissau's People using at least basic sanitation services (% of population) was 28.94.

That's up 0.4% from 2023, the highest value on record.

The global average for this indicator in 2024 was 80.77 . Guinea-Bissau ranks #180 globally out of 193 reporting countries. Within Sub-Saharan Africa, it ranks #32 of 44.

Source: World Bank Open Data (SH.STA.BASS.ZS) • Data as of 2024

About People using at least basic sanitation services (% of population)

The percentage of people using at least basic sanitation services, that is, improved sanitation facilities that are not shared with other households. This indicator encompasses both people using basic sanitation services as well as those using safely managed sanitation services. Improved sanitation facilities include flush/pour flush to piped sewer systems, septic tanks or pit latrines; ventilated improved pit latrines, compositing toilets or pit latrines with slabs.
